I fill mine with air and have a pressure gauge on my water pump plate with an on/off valve and let it sit with 50psi of air and see IF it will hold 50 psi check it in the morning. IF its down, then re pressure the block and start with the water & soap spray bottle. IF still at 50 in the morning a shout of joy and a Fess Parker skippitdy do!!!
